For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 87 students in Valley Union High School District (4190). This district's average test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Arizona.
Public School in Valley Union High School District (4190) have an average math proficiency score of 20% (versus the Arizona public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 20% (versus the 41%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arizona public school average of 66%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$26,805 is higher than the state median of $11,429. The school district revenue/student has grown by 23%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$24,966 is higher than the state median of $11,331. The school district spending/student has grown by 21% over four school years.
